Transforming Spaces with Style
Versatile curtains bring style and practicality together. Whether it is a living room, bedroom, or office, the flexibility in design ensures that curtains complement the overall aesthetic. Popular options include:
- Sheer Curtains: Light-filtering and airy, ideal for creating soft, natural light while maintaining privacy.
- Blackout Curtains: Perfect for bedrooms and media rooms, offering total light control and enhanced comfort.
- Layered Curtains: Combining sheer and opaque fabrics provides adaptability for mood, lighting, and decor.
- Patterned Curtains: Subtle patterns or bold prints can either harmonize with existing interiors or serve as a focal point.
Material Matters for Every Interior
The choice of fabric significantly impacts the ambiance and versatility of curtains. Natural fabrics like cotton and linen offer a relaxed and breathable feel, perfect for casual and coastal interiors. Synthetic blends add durability and easy maintenance, making them ideal for high-traffic areas. Key fabric options include:
- Lightweight fabrics for airy, open atmospheres.
- Heavier materials for a formal, luxurious look.
- Textured fabrics to add depth and visual interest.
Color and Design Flexibility
Colors and designs play a crucial role in the adaptability of curtains. Neutral shades like beige, grey, and soft pastels easily blend with diverse interior palettes. For bolder statements, jewel tones or striking patterns can bring energy and personality to a room. Tips for versatility include:
- Matching curtain colors to existing wall or furniture tones.
- Using reversible or two-tone curtains for multiple styling options.
- Choosing patterns that coordinate with accessories rather than overpower them.

Functional Benefits for Everyday Living
Beyond aesthetics, versatile curtains enhance comfort and convenience in everyday life. They improve energy efficiency by insulating windows, reduce noise, and provide privacy without sacrificing style. Additional benefits include:
- Easy customization for varying window sizes and shapes.
- Compatibility with modern curtain rods, tracks, and motorized systems.
- Low-maintenance fabrics that retain color and structure over time.
